Households, community groups and schools are encouraged to register now for Australia’s biggest weekend of garage sales on October 20 and 21 .
Last year, 54 garage sales were held in the region as hundreds of locals grabbed a bargain and supported the reduce reuse recycle movement.

Spring clean, conquer your clutter this Garage Sale Trail
• 88 per cent of Aussies have at least one cluttered room
• Australia’s biggest garage sale, Garage Sale Trail, is happening in communities across Australia on 20 and 21 October
• Average household has $4,200 in unwanted items, and a staggering 50 per cent admit to throwing these unwanted items away.
Garage Sale Trail started in Bondi Beach in 2010 with support from Waverley Council.
Today, it’s an event powered by 148 councils nationally, with 400,000 Australians anticipated to list more than 2 million items for sale and reuse at over 15,000 garage sales and stalls across the country this year.
“We’re incredibly proud to be one of the 148 councils who support the Garage Sale Trail and the positive impacts it fosters in communities across the nation,” Snowy Monaro Regional Council mayor John Rooney said.
“There was a fantastic response from our community last year for the Garage Sale Trail, and this year we hope even more garage sales are held.“
